
Hieronymos II
Hieronymos II is the current Archbishop of Athens and the head of the Greek Orthodox Church. He has been a prominent figure in promoting dialogue between different Christian denominations and addressing contemporary social issues. Recently, he was in the news for his discussions with Pope Francis during a visit to Greece, highlighting interfaith cooperation and humanitarian concerns.
